3276 Buckingham Springs Road Dillwyn, VA - Presented here is a rare opportunity to acquire a historic farmstead in rural central Virginia that is sure to enchant for generations to come. Long known by locals as "the Springs", the story of this property is rooted in centuries of Morris Family ownership. It was made famous in the 1800s by the enterprising Samuel Morris who operated a successful health resort called Buckingham Springs, where guests partook in the purported healing benefits of the local mineral spring water. While the hotel and cottages are long gone, the 4-story structure known as The Morris House (c. 1810) stands renovated (2011) to modern standards, ensuring an elegant home with historic appeal and present day conveniences.
